I know it's available physically for PSP, and you can get the OG version on PS2, but Tekken 5: Dark Resurrection deserves a mention anyways. It doesn't have trophies, but many Tekken fans consider this version to be the best game in the entire series. This version was never released physically on PS3, and was never released on consoles/PC outside of PS3. Meaning when it's gone, the only way to get it is if you pick up a PSP and the physical version of this game. If you like Tekken or fighting games in general this is an absolute must buy. There's a $15 version and a $20 version. The $20 version has access to online play whereas the $15 version doesn't.
